The managerial responsibilities of today's supervisor continue to evolve as companies compete in this fast moving business environment. To be successful, front-line managers must master a diverse set of technical, human relations and conceptual skills. Challenges include dealing with an increasingly diverse workforce, empowering employees, encouraging teamwork, enhancing employee performance, ensuring health and safety and improving productivity and quality. Successful completion of this program will help new managers develop skills and confidence, as well as provide experienced managers with new tools to enrich their career path.
